Hi there and welcome, I have no accress to you tube so I havn,t seen the page cousine link provides. In general

Keeping snapshots before disassembly at each stage. 

Device work area to keep flging parts on planet earth.

Check if balance pivots stay in jewels as you gently lift one side of the wheel with tweezer, also how well incabs hold the jewel inside it's housing.

Also, the functioning of  every movement part and the entire power train, release the m/s power before removing the fork...

When servicing/repairing it's a little bit biased just like in any trade, some prefer tools from a certain manufacturer, some have a favorite oil/grease manufacturer.
How to oil/grease the watch you work with is just like when a technician is servicing your car, the manufacturer has a service schedule he has to follow so you can keep the warranty on your car and so do the movement manufacturers too, here you can find the ETA service documents.

https://secure.eta.ch/CSP/DefaultDesktop.aspx?tabindex=2&tabid=28

Professionals often get certified at Watch manufacturers and by that get access to their service supply chain. It works the same in any trade.

But after a while the warranty is no longer valid since time wears everything down even me. It's then one can begin to service/repair your watch by you self, I guess there are plenty of people in this forum who fixed some easy fault on an old car or even made an oil change or two on it.
When doing that one might not always have access to the correct oil, spare part or service documents ,it's now when one can use a "general chart" as the one from Moebious.
One can see they have compiled the most common functions in a watch and listed the components performing the tasks to achieve the function.
To make this chart more generic one could change the oil/grease from the manufacturers definitions to some definitions like Fine oil, Thick oil, Grease and so on.
This could give you a chance to choose lubrication from a different manufacturer if you have a feeling of the different definitions.

There can't be a "standard" because lubricants have evolved over decades. It is like if one was to insist using the exact original types when for a car manufactured 90 or even just 40 years ago. They aren't available anymore and for very good reasons, fortunately something better is.
